§ 255-4130. Appeals to the Zoning Board of Review.

  • A. An appeal to the Board from a decision of the ZEO in the enforcement of this chapter may be taken by any person, officer, department or board of the Town or state aggrieved or affected by such decision or other action taken by the ZEO. Any appeal must be taken within thirty (30) days of the recording of the decision or action by the Building Inspector or the ZEO by filing a notice of appeal with the Clerk for the Zoning Board of Review setting forth the grounds for or reasons of appeal. The Building Inspector or the ZEO shall transmit to the Board all the records upon which the decision or action was based. Any appeal to the Board shall stay all actions or proceedings, including penalties and fines, in furtherance of the decision or action appealed from, unless the Building Inspector or ZEO certifies to the Board that a stay would cause imminent peril to life, life safety or property. In such a case, proceedings shall not be stayed other than by a restraining order granted by a Court of competent jurisdiction.

  • B. In exercising its powers the Board may reverse or affirm, in whole or in part, and may modify the order, requirement, decision, or determination appealed from and may make such orders, requirements, decisions, or determinations as ought to be made, and, to that end, shall have the powers of the officer from whom the appeal was taken. All decisions and records of the Board respecting appeals shall conform to the provisions of Code § 255-430E.
